So, one of the things I love using my saber for is practicing sword katas for my martial arts training.   This morning I picked up my Sentinel V5 LE and started my kata, only to have the blade die half-way through.  This was followed by the "Obsidian" boot-up clip.

This is the sure sign of nearly dead batteries.  :-)

So, with a slight pout of disappointment, I stepped back to my office and racked my saber, put a note on my phone to pick up some AAA batteries, and pulled up my work...    And realized, after sitting down that I had not finished my Kata!   

Apparently I can't do the thing if the saber is shut off.  LOL

So, the question: Has this ever happened to you?  Do you stop your activity when your saber batteries check out?   

It just made me laugh.  Smiley  Hope it gives y'all a chuckle as well!

I've had that issue and if you're using AAA batteries, it's either one or a few of the batteries slightly popped out or they died. I typically warp electrical tape around the batteries and then use velcro strips running both horizontally and vertically to keep the battery case from floating around
